Base Game

Rip City is a video slot from Hacksaw Gaming that features 5 reels, 5 rows, and 19 paylines. Players can choose between a Min.bet of 0.10 and a Max.bet of 100. The game has an RTP of 96.22% and a hit frequency of 18.22%, implying that, on average, you can expect a winning combination on almost every 5th spin. RIP City is played at medium volatility and has a potential max win of 12.500x the bet

As we are used to in Hacksaw slots, RIP City treats us with plenty of exciting aspects to explore. The features are Wild Symbol, Scatter Symbol, Wild Cat Symbol, Ro$$ Bonus, Maxx Bonus, and Bonus Buys

RIP City can be played on all common mobile devices and desktops. A winning combination is created by landing 3 or more matching symbols on consecutive reels within the game’s lines, starting from the leftmost reel. 

The lower-paying symbols consist of 10, J, Q, K, and A. A full line of 5 with one of these pays 5x-10x the bet. The higher-paying symbols include bananas, skulls, dice, smiley, and billiard balls. Five-of-a-kind with these will pay 15x-20x the bet. The Wild symbols substitute for other paying symbols. Ro$$ is an expanding Wild symbol, and 3 or more Scatter symbols (FS) trigger the free spins feature.

Wild Symbol

Wild symbols enable more winning combinations by substituting for other paying symbols. 

Scatter Symbol

Landing 3 or 4 Scatter symbols triggers the Ro$$ Bonus or Maxx Bonus, respectively. 

Wild Cat Symbol

Wild Cat symbols expand if the expanded symbol would be part of at least one winning combination. These expand downward, to the bottom of the grid. If a Wild Cat symbol expands through a Wild symbol, it turns into a multiplier that is applied to the whole expanded Wild Cat symbol. Wild multipliers can have the following values: 2x, 3x, 4x, 5x, 6x, 7x, 8x, 9x, 10x, 15x, 20x, 25x, 50x, 100x, and 200x. If more than one multiplier is included in a win, the values will be added together. 

Ro$$ Bonus

Landing 3 Scatter symbols will award 10 Free Spins in the Ro$$ Bonus. During this feature, you have a higher chance of landing Wild Cat symbols and Wild symbols than in the base game. Landing 3 Scatter symbols within the bonus game award 4 additional Free Spins, and 4 Scatters triggers the Maxx Bonus. 

Maxx Bonus

Landing 4 Scatter symbols award 10 Free Spins in the Maxx Bonus. In this feature, each reel can be activated by landing a Wild Cat symbol on that reel. Once a reel is activated, a Wild Cat symbol is guaranteed to land on that reel on all remaining Free Spins. Landing 3 Scatters awards an additional 4 Free Spins.

Bonus Buys

If you want to add some extra spice to your session, there are 5 different Feature Buys:

3X = Each spin is 5x times more likely to activate a bonus game.
20x = Each spin guarantees that at least 2 Wild Cat symbols land.
50x = Each spin guarantees that at least 3 Wild Cat symbols land.
110x = Activates the Ro$$ Bonus
200x = Activates the Maxx Bonus.
